热文MySQL字符集选择不当引发的乱码问题
在MySQL中,字符集的选择对于处理文本数据时可能出现的乱码问题至关重要。 1. **不同语言**:每种语言都有自己的字符集。例如,英文通常使用`UTF8`或`ANSI`(美
在MySQL中,字符集的选择对于处理文本数据时可能出现的乱码问题至关重要。 1. **不同语言**:每种语言都有自己的字符集。例如,英文通常使用`UTF8`或`ANSI`(美
在MySQL中,事务(Transaction)是一种数据库操作的单位。当一组SQL语句作为一个整体执行并且满足ACID(原子性、一致性、隔离性和持久性)原则时,我们就说这些SQ
MySQL索引优化不足可能会导致查询性能瓶颈。以下是一些可能的问题和分析: 1. **缺乏索引**:如果频繁访问的列没有对应的索引,数据库将不得不全表扫描,效率极低。 2.
MySQL存储过程频繁崩溃可能由多种因素引起,下面我将提供一些常见的问题分析及调试方法: 1. **语法错误**: - 存储过程中可能存在拼写错误、遗漏关键字等。
在MySQL中,当你的表结构发生变化时,如果不正确地进行更新或迁移,确实可能会导致数据一致性问题。 例如: 1. 增加字段:如果在新增字段后直接写入旧格式的数据,可能导致新
MySQL查询效率低下可能由以下几个原因引起,针对每个原因,我们都会提供相应的解决策略: 1. 数据库设计不合理: - 冗余数据过多:建议优化表结构,删除冗余数据。
MySQL多租户(Multi-tenant)模式允许在同一数据库服务器上为多个独立的客户群体提供服务。这种模式的好处包括资源利用率高、管理方便等。 以下是设置和管理MySQL
在MySQL数据库中,数据类型的混淆是一个常见的问题。这可能会导致数据错误、存储空间浪费或者查询效率低下等问题。以下是一些具体的混淆问题以及相应的解决策略: 1. **数值型
MySQL(一个开源的关系型数据库管理系统)的性能瓶颈可能涉及多个方面。以下是如何诊断和解决这些问题的一般步骤: 1. **性能监控**: - 使用内置的性能分析工具,
在MySQL中,存储引擎是负责数据的物理存储和处理的核心组件。选择合适的存储引擎对于数据库性能、可扩展性和安全性都有重要影响。以下是一些最佳实践案例分析: 1. InnoDB
在MySQL连接问题中,服务器和客户端之间确实存在一些挑战。以下是常见的几个方面: 1. **网络稳定性**:数据传输依赖于稳定的网络环境,任何网络中断都可能导致连接失败。
SQL注入(Structured Query Language Injection)是数据库安全领域的一种常见攻击方式。这种攻击主要是通过在用户输入的数据中插入恶意的SQL代码
在MySQL中,并发访问可能会遇到各种错误。以下是一些常见的例子: 1. **锁竞争(Lock Contention)**:当多个事务同时尝试获取同一资源的锁时,可能会引发冲
MySQL索引是数据库优化的重要手段,它能显著提升查询性能。以下是几个主要原因: 1. **加速数据查找**: 索引类似于书籍的目录,你可以快速找到特定条目而无需逐页翻
MySQL高可用方案中的故障排查与恢复流程主要包括以下几个步骤: 1. **监控系统**: - 系统日志:检查MySQL服务器的日志,如错误信息、警告等。 - 监
MySQL日志是数据库运行过程中的重要记录,包括查询日志、二进制日志(binlog)等。在数据库运维和故障排查中,理解和正确管理MySQL日志至关重要。 以下是关于MySQL
在大型项目中,为了避免MySQL常见的设计问题,可以遵循以下几个步骤: 1. **明确需求**: 首先要清楚项目的目标和功能需求,这将指导后续的设计决策。 2. **
在MySQL数据库中,权限设置是至关重要的。如果设置不当,可能会导致数据泄露、权限滥用等问题。以下是一些常见的MySQL权限问题以及示例: 1. **无访问权限**:
当在MySQL中进行索引优化时,可能会遇到一些问题。这里我们将这些问题进行分析,并提供可能的解决方案。 1. **索引未覆盖查询条件**: 当你的查询不完全依赖于某个索
MySQL是一个强大的关系数据库管理系统,备份和恢复是其重要环节。以下是一些常见的MySQL备份恢复问题以及解决方案: 1. **备份失败**:如网络故障、磁盘空间不足等。解
MySQL集群管理是多服务器协同工作,为高可用性和数据扩展提供解决方案。以下是几个关键问题以及相应的应对策略: 1. **负载均衡**: - 应对策略:通过工具如Per
MySQL作为全球广泛使用的开源关系型数据库管理系统,其稳定性是衡量系统可靠性和性能的重要指标。在实际使用中,MySQL系统可能会面临以下稳定性挑战: 1. 数据负载:随着数
MySQL是许多应用数据库的首选,但随着数据量的增长和业务复杂性的提高,可能会遇到一些性能瓶颈。以下是10种常见的MySQL性能问题以及相应的解决方案: 1. **查询效率低
确实,早期的MySQL版本在密码安全方面存在一些问题。以下是弱密码问题的一些例子: 1. **简单密码**:用户可能会选择诸如"password"、"123456"等容易被猜
在MySQL中,触发器是一种特殊类型的存储过程,它会自动被执行,且执行的时机由你事先定义。 如果发现触发器的功能失效,可能的原因如下: 1. 触发条件设置错误:确保你的触发
在MySQL中,动态分区是一种根据业务需求实时调整分区的方式。但若遇到分区规则不明确的问题,可能会导致动态分区策略无效。 以下是解决这类问题的一些建议: 1. **理解分区
在MySQL数据库的权限管理中,如果操作不当,就可能导致用户权限滥用的情况发生。下面是一个具体的案例: 1. **账户创建**: 某管理员在创建新员工账户时,给一个初级
当MySQL备份文件损坏时,备份恢复操作会失败。这种情况通常由以下原因导致: 1. **磁盘错误**:在备份或读取过程中,硬盘可能出现物理损伤,导致文件损坏。 2. **电
在MySQL中,事务是一系列操作,这些操作要么全部成功,要么全部失败。如果中间出现错误,事务将回滚到初始状态。 隔离级别不匹配的案例通常出现在并发环境下: 1. **读未提
当你在MySQL中误操作,删除了一个字段后,可能会遇到以下问题: 1. 数据丢失:被删除的字段可能包含重要的数据,这样就导致数据丢失。 2. 查询错误:如果这个字段是你查询
在MySQL中,索引是提高查询性能的重要工具。如果索引失效,会导致查询效率低下。以下是一些索引失效的常见案例: 1. **没有建立索引**: - 插入大量数据时,因为每
在MySQL中,如果存储过程中出现了参数传递的问题,可能会有以下几种情况: 1. **参数类型不匹配**: 如果传入的参数类型与存储过程定义的参数类型不符,会导致错误。
在MySQL中,连接断开的问题通常表现为以下几种错误: 1. **"Connection lost"**:这是最直接的提示,表示你尝试建立的MySQL连接已经丢失。 2.
MySQL(My Structured Database)是全球广泛使用的开源关系数据库管理系统。然而,像任何其他软件一样,MySQL也可能存在安全漏洞。 识别方法: 1.
在 MySQL 存储过程中,可能会遇到性能瓶颈。这些问题通常源于以下几个方面: 1. **查询效率低**:如果存储过程中的 SQL 查询复杂度高或者使用了不高效的索引,就会导